摘要

A method for preparation of bio-renewable, biodegradable, biocompostable and biodigestible agricultural vegetal waste-peptide-polyolefin polymer composite includes the following step: mixing at least one type of peptide, and/or at least one type of protein and enzyme and a composting agent and an additive to form a mixture, forming peptide-polyolefin polymer pellets through plasticization and combination with at least one type of polyolefin polymer, adding fine powder of ground dried renewable agricultural vegetal waste powder and a plastic assisting agent, and compounding and extruding with a twin-screw type extruder or a kneader mixer for forming pellet to obtain bio-renewable, biodegradable, biocompostable and biodigestible agricultural vegetal waste-peptide-polyolefin polymer pellets.
